  • Nalbandian, Berdych withdraw from Madrid

    5/11/10 10:39 PM | Kelli DeMario
    Nalbandian, Berdych withdraw from Madrid Both Tomas Berdych and former Madrid champion David Nalbandian withdrew prior to their first-round meeting, citing injury. The two were replaced by lucky losers Mardy Fish and Michael Russell.

    Injury woes continue to plague 2007 Madrid champion David Nalbandian, as he was forced to withdraw before contesting his opener with 11th seed Tomas Berdych Tuesday evening. The Argentine has had numerous bouts with injury this season, halting his comeback after undergoing hip surgery in 2009. The 28-year-old pulled out of Madrid with a left leg issue, leaving his participation at the French Open undetermined.

    World No. 16 Tomas Berdych, slated to begin the tournament as the 11th seed, withdrew from competition as well, citing a right hip issue. The former Madrid semifinalist was on course to capture his 23rd match-win of the year.

    The winner of the Fish-Russell match will move on to face Jurgen Melzer in the round of 16 on Wednesday.
